About The Position

Coordinate surgery scheduling and determination of ancillary procedures. Responsible for providing all necessary information and guidance regarding the surgery to the patient. May produce reports that compile various surgery statistics for departmental use.

Responsibilities

  • Schedules and coordinates surgical cases with corresponding ancillary tests and arrangements by recognizing the differences between various types of procedures and differences between patients' needs within the same procedure.
  • Recommends surgery times and dates to physicians to assure that adequate space and time is allowed for completion of the surgery based on knowledge of the procedure. Maintains a thorough understanding of the logistical requirements of each procedure and the individual needs of each physician.
  • Assures that the scheduling of each surgical case is conducted and scheduled properly in the appropriate area based on knowledge of the facilities available in each room and within the guidelines set up by each area and within their established timeframe.
  • Prepares necessary patient reports for physicians and the department as a whole based on knowledge of the procedures performed.
  • Maintains knowledge of all necessary computer programs used in the scheduling process that may include Cycare, Clinipac, McCormick-Dodge OR Scheduler, etc.
  • Reviews future schedules based on physicians' schedules to best utilize the available operating rooms; makes recommendations to surgeons based on this information.
  • Processes and reviews incoming and outgoing surgery-related documents and forms.
  • Provides guidance to patient regarding logistics of the surgery; assists patient with submission of insurance and preliminary financial arrangements and pre-certifies surgeries with appropriate insurance companies; makes necessary arrangements with patient for accommodations. Acts as a resource regarding all logistical aspects of the surgical process.
